1U5796 Pressure Differential Gauge Group Available For Load Sensing Hydraulic Systems and Differential Steering System{0770,0784,5050}

Usage:


416, 426, 428 Backhoe Loaders;
Series G Motor Graders;
D4H, D5H, D6H, D7H, D8N Tractors;
508 Skidders;
943, 953, 963, 973 Loaders

A 1U5796 Pressure Differential Gauge Group is available to verify and set the margin pressure on load sensing hydraulic systems on the above machines, and for the differential steering system on D8N Tractors. The group includes a 1U5793 Pressure Differential Gauge which measures directly the difference between two pressures (Delta P). See illustration. Changes in pressure differences cause the pressure sensor in the differential gauge to move the pointer in proportion to the changes. The gauge has a magnetic movement and pressures higher than the pressure indicated on the dial will not damage the gauge.


The differential pressure gauge group in the handy carrying case.

The maximum pressure differential that can be measured is 3450 kPa (500 psi). The maximum working pressure of the lines and fittings is 52 000 kPa (7500 psi).

An 8T859 and 8T861 Pressure Gauge for measuring the maximum system pressure are included in the group.


NOTICE

The 8T859 Gauge is for use only up to 24 800 kPa (3600 psi). The 8T861 Gauge is for use up to 60 000 kPa (8700 psi). Be sure the proper gauge is used to measure the system working pressure.
